Q: Is 269,650 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 269,650 is a composite number.

Why is 269,650 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 269,650 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 25 50 5,393 10,786 26,965 53,930 134,825 and 269,650, with no remainder.

Since 269,650 cannot be divided by just 1 and 269,650, it is a composite number.
